For the 16th time under Tom Izzo, the Michigan State men’s basketball team has advanced to the Sweet 16. The Spartans took down New Mexico, 71-63, and will take on Ole Miss on Friday at 7:09 p.m.

The 2025 NCAA Women’s Basketball Championship will host the Final Four and National Championship games at Amalie Arena in Tampa, Florida, on April 4 and 6. This marks a significant event for the city, aligning with the dedication of local sports commissions to promote women's basketball at various levels.
Favorites went undefeated with a perfect 8-0 record in the Sweet 16 for the first time since 1985, per Evan Abrams of Action Network. Teams favored by at least seven points in the 2025 tournament are also 26-1 overall, with the only loss being No. 5 Clemson's first-round defeat at the hands of No. 12 McNeese State.
